Sunburst Salad
Sunburst Salad is a vibrant and creamy dessert featuring orange gelatin, cottage cheese, pineapple, and Cool Whip. Its bright flavors and smooth texture make it a delightful treat suitable for parties, potlucks, or family gatherings, offering a refreshing and visually appealing dish for any occasion.

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ine the dry orange jello with the cottage cheese.
- Blend well until smooth.
- Mix in the drained crushed pineapple.
- Fold in the Cool Whip and orange segments.
- Place the mixture in a serving bowl.
- Chill in the refrigerator before serving.
Tips & Substitutions
For a lighter version, consider using low-fat cottage cheese and sugar-free jello. You can also substitute the Cool Whip with Greek yogurt for a tangy twist. If you prefer a firmer texture, reduce the amount of pineapple or drain it well to avoid excess moisture. Always blend the jello and cottage cheese thoroughly to achieve a smooth consistency.

Storage & Reheating
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. The salad may lose some of its texture over time, so it's best enjoyed fresh. If you need to serve it again, give it a gentle stir before serving, but avoid adding extra Cool Whip or jello to maintain the original flavor.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I make this salad 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are this salad a day in advance. Just ensure that you store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. This allows the flavors to meld beautifully, although be cautious as the texture might slightly change. Serve it chilled for the best taste and experience.
What can I use instead of Cool Whip?
If you prefer a healthier substitute, you can use whipped coconut cream or homemade whipped cream. Simply whip heavy cream until soft peaks form and fold it into the mixture gently. This will give you a similar fluffy texture without the additives found in store-bought Cool Whip.
Can I add other fruits to this salad?
Absolutely! Feel free to incorporate other fruits like mandarin oranges, strawberries, or sliced bananas for added flavor and texture. Just make sure to adjust the amount of pineapple to maintain the overall balance of the salad, ensuring it doesn't become too watery.
